Book Description

September 25, 2002
A science book that demonstrates God's intricate handiwork, reflecting His glory and wisdom. Much of what makes each one of us unique and special is traced to our genetic code. This book is filled with information on genetics and the scientific advances in biotechnology. It is fun to read, and has many illustrations, including several exercises. This book is appropriate for late elementary/middle-school students in either the classroom or homeschooling.

About the Author

N. Lucia Eskeland and N. Celeste Bailey earned doctoral degrees in Biomedical Sciences at the Mount Sinai School of Medicine in New York City. Subsequently, they did post-graduate work at the University of California in San Diego. The focus of Dr. Eskeland’s research has been in molecular biology, pharmacology and endocrinology. Dr. Bailey’s work has been in the fields of immunology, cellular biology and molecular biology. They have both published articles in prominent scientific journals. Dr. Bailey is an adjunct faculty at National University. Dr. Eskeland is a member of Society of Children's Book Writers and Illustrators (SCBWI). Both authors live in Southern California with their families.
